2016 Marks the 80th anniversary of the victory of the Red Army's Long March. A crew of more than 100 people from CCTV's large-scale documentary "Long March" divided into five groups and retraced the footsteps of the Red Army's Long March. They visited and photographed a large number of relics and characters. The 500-person post-production team demonstrated the Long March spirit of the Communists' iron-clad faith, iron-clad faith, iron-clad discipline, and iron-clad responsibility through panoramic reproduction, international perspective narration, oral accounts of those who experienced it, and quantitative interpretation of data.
In 2017, on the occasion of the 90th anniversary of the founding of the Chinese People's Liberation Army, we will share the words and pictures of re-taking the Long March with the audience and readers. In memory of the immortal Long March, we are always on the road.
